January 6, 2022 – Wellness care in the United States is in the midst of a gradual but accelerating evolution as health and fitness treatment devices and suppliers shift their emphasis from dealing with sickness to supporting wellness. Some widespread phrases dropped in the health and fitness care neighborhood nowadays involve social determinants of health, group wellness, and functional drugs, which expose that modern overall health care issues are directed at a little something much far more holistic than treating a ill patient’s indicators immediately after a 15-minute medical analysis.

Health care providers have typically relied upon a fee-for-support model, in which, frequently, every single clinical assistance supplied is billed and reimbursed. Today, however, wellbeing care suppliers are progressively collaborating within just numerous versions of treatment that deal with the wellness treatment wants of an determined populace and that foundation payment upon quality of care and improved outcomes to the well being of the inhabitants as a full.

Amongst such collaborations, the clinically built-in network (CIN) can be rather efficient in terms of organizing well being treatment vendors to boost general good quality through effectiveness measurement, value and effectiveness. CINs represent a design of well being care that integrates bigger businesses like hospitals with a community of professionals and independent physicians.

In a properly-made CIN, sufferers carry on to see their extended-time primary care medical professionals but have access to an complete technique of specialists who are integrated in a way that focuses on strengthening the unique client knowledge and overall health outcomes. To attain this, a high-quality CIN makes use of facts-sharing constructions to preserve and keep track of a patient’s full medical heritage (not just billable events), which enhances the high quality of the information and boosts the client expertise.

Recent traits point out CINs make a substantial effects in improving the over-all top quality and expense of client care, which payment-for-top quality steps are made to achieve when they are thoroughly created and managed. Think about, for example, that one of the measures a lot of health treatment experts concentrate on to make certain high-quality is the Triple Aim of health treatment, a established of guidelines to aid make certain that a wellbeing program is operating as proficiently as doable. CINs have come to be the preferred vehicle by which well being units make sure they are progressing towards achieving these Aims.

The Triple Purpose was designed by the Institute for Healthcare Improvement (IHI) in 2007 in get to build priorities for a modern wellbeing care system. In 2010, it was integrated into the U.S. nationwide approach for health care, earning it amazingly salient for all American health treatment corporations. The plans are easy. According to the IHI, in buy to give the optimum quality of care, wellness care techniques and suppliers really should target on:

(1) Strengthening the client practical experience of treatment.

(2) Lessening the for every capita cost of health care.

(3) Enhancing the health and fitness of populations.

The client populace a CIN manages might consider several types. For example, a CIN might negotiate with a payor to manage the well being care of an identified populace and get upside and downside fiscal possibility associated with the very same it may perhaps deal to care for just one or more employers’ self-insured staff populations or it may detect a neighborhood require to handle a individual underserved affected person inhabitants. The point is for the CIN to discover the specific wellbeing treatment demands of a population, and the attendant expenses in addressing people demands, and to organize in a meaningful and purposeful way to handle the very same to goal for good quality outcomes for the particular person affected individual and the population as a entire.

In a 2015 analyze released by IHI, CINs have revealed they are productively structured to fulfill the Triple Aim when they achieve a several markers. These markers include:

•Creating a foundation for populace administration of an recognized inhabitants. This features a potent governance construction and a sense of objective.

•Ensuring scalability as the CIN varieties, develops, and grows, as the experience of the companies in the CIN will have to accommodate the specific demands of the client populace.

•Establishing a learning system to generate and sustain the function above time, which most usually features (most likely, even requires) powerful and secure data sharing between vendors to allow them to monitor individual decisions and impression on their overall health. See Pursuing the Triple Intention: The Very first 7 A long time, The Milbank Quarterly, June 2015, 93(2): 263-300.

The most important takeaway listed here is that success can take time and perseverance to collaborate from the top rated down. To achieve the Triple Goal, a CIN need to strategically recognize and organize close to individual care goals and create supply types that reach all those goals at a reduced cost. To do this nicely, a CIN need to fully grasp its goal individual population’s desires, review information to figure out correct clinical responses to these desires, and keep an eye on its providers’ shipping of these medical steps.

Health and fitness care, on the other hand, is something but stagnant. Consequently, CINs should continue being acutely aware of, flexible with, and responsive to patient population requires. CINs need to make certain that the most up-to-date details on each individual patient is quickly available for shipping of patient treatment and will have to employ their medical facts to far better fully grasp and respond to the focus on population’s well being outcomes and requires. CINs need to have to build constructions and equipment to do this.

As wellness treatment suppliers take into consideration integration in a CIN, they need to, initially and foremost, undertake watchful and attentive organizing to ensure compliance with the wellness treatment laws pertaining to referrals between wellness treatment suppliers. As wellbeing treatment suppliers within just a CIN commence to believe collectively, with a shared concentration on the overall health wants of a unique client population, they will inevitably require to consider and plan for referring individuals to other companies within the CIN who fully grasp the value-based aims of the CIN and the most efficacious treatment of the affected individual.

The affected person data shared and utilized among suppliers in the CIN and the understanding the well being care providers in the CIN achieve by examining the facts to boost affected person treatment and reduce expenses need to drive the referrals produced in the CIN. Fortuitously, major regulatory reform has transpired above the last numerous several years to figure out the movement absent from price-for-company to benefit-based mostly arrangements, and referrals in just a CIN that is correctly structured can deliver substantial value to the overall health and fitness of the patients in the CIN.

The Anti-kickback Statute and the Stark Legislation, for occasion, now provide policies to safeguard meticulously built price-based arrangements, the place wellbeing care suppliers are equipped to care for and correctly refer individuals inside a CIN. See 42 CFR § 411.357(aa) (Stark Law exception) and42 CFR § 1001.952(ee) – (gg) (Anti-kickback Safe and sound Harbors). Each individual regulation needs thing to consider of what amount of economical chance is associated for the get-togethers to the arrangement, and remuneration paid under the arrangement have to be for authentic value-based routines.

On top of that, as physicians within a CIN contemplate the referrals to be made within the CIN, especially those people that are needed by the CIN by itself in its agreement, procedures and/or strategies, they want to ensure almost nothing can be construed as an inducement to furnish medically needless products or solutions or, on the other hand, lower or restrict medically important merchandise or expert services.

To guard towards such inducement, the regulatory restrictions on doctor referrals involve:

(1) there can be no need to refer individuals not component of the CIN and the value-based arrangement

(2) the referral requirement need to be in creating and

(3) the referral necessity will have to not use if the client expresses a motivation for a diverse service provider or supplier, the insurer decides that a distinct company or supplier be applied or the doctor decides a referral inside the CIN is not in the patient’s most effective health care interests.

Beyond considering these laws pertaining to affected person referrals, individuals looking to sort or sign up for a CIN require to engage expert wellbeing care counsel to fully vet other relevant legislation associated to antitrust concerns as nicely as to maintaining the privacy and security of the individual information. Every single of these lawful concerns will involve a simple fact-unique analysis of the CIN by itself and how it will operate.

As wellbeing treatment reimbursement moves further more absent from payment-for-assistance toward payment for excellent of treatment and price-based mostly results, the CIN will undoubtedly be an engaging design for overall health treatment providers. By its inherent composition, a CIN can lead to revolutionary ways for offering and accomplishing bigger concentrations of treatment for individuals even though operating to decrease fees at the exact same time.
